This list comes from Forbes, after careful calculation…here are the top 5 actors who bring the most value! . In 5th place is Shia Labeouf. For every $1 LaBeouf is paid, his films earn an average $29.40. Labeoff is a part of one of the biggest franchises Transformers which is a part of the billion dollar club…not bad! . 4th place goes to my favorite wizard, Daniel Ratcliffe…for For every $1 Radcliffe is paid, his films earn an average $34.24…also a member of the billion dollar club for his involvement in the harry potter franchise. . The 3rd most valuable actor is Rob Pattinson…known for his role as Edward in The Twilight Saga, for every buck good ol Edward takes in, his films earn about $39.43! . In 2nd place is Miss Anne Hathaway! For every dollar she gets paid, her movies earn about $45.67…you guys can check anne out next as selena kyle aka catwoman in the dark knight rises! . And finally in first place, is the everyone’s favorite human, turned vampire, Kristen Stweart, also kown for her star power in Twilight…for every dollar she makes, her films bring in about $55.38. . Looney Tunes Super Stars Tweety and Sylvester — Admirer
When Friz Freleng directed 1947′s “Tweetie Pie,” he may not have known he was making history. This, the first pairing of Sylvester the sputtering cat and Tweetie (later Tweety) the wide-eyed canary, won an Academy Award and united a duo that would appear in more than 40 Warner Brothers cartoon shorts by 1962. Sylvester and Tweety earned their studio another Academy Award for 1957′s “Birds Anonymous” and several other Oscar nominations through the years. Generations of Americans have grown up watching Sylvester’s classic, ever-thwarted attempts to catch Tweety. With two of the most famous voices in cartoons, both supplied by Mel Blanc, Sylvester’s sloppy “sufferin succotash” and Tweety’s baby-voiced “I tawt I taw a puddy tat,” Sylvester and Tweety are two of the most quickly identified characters in cartoons. ER, the most Emmy-nominated show in television history, continues its incredible in-depth look into the lives of the doctors of a public hospital emergency room and the immense daily pressures they face. The longest-running medical drama in American primetime television returns once again as Warner Home Video releases ER: The Complete Thirteenth Season on DVD on July 6, 2010.
